The Power of Generative Models

 

Synthetic data is not a new concept. For years, it has been used in various industries, including gaming, computer graphics, and physics simulations. What has truly revolutionized its application in AI is the advancement of generative models, most notably, Generative Adversarial Networks (GANs) and Variational Autoencoders (VAEs).

 

These generative models have the ability to create data that is indistinguishable from real data, both visually and statistically. GANs, for instance, consist of a generator and a discriminator network that compete against each other, leading to the creation of highly realistic synthetic data. VAEs, on the other hand, learn the underlying data distribution and generate data points from it.

 

Advantages of Synthetic Data

 

Privacy Preservation: One of the foremost advantages of synthetic data is that it can be generated without compromising privacy. This is particularly critical in fields like healthcare and finance, where sensitive data is involved. Synthetic medical records or financial transactions can be used for training AI models without revealing confidential patient or customer information.

 

Data Augmentation: Synthetic data can be used to augment existing real-world datasets, enhancing their diversity and making AI models more robust. By generating synthetic data from known distributions, AI developers can create variations of the data that can help models generalize better.

 

Unlimited Data Availability: Unlike real-world data, synthetic data is not constrained by availability. AI developers can generate as much data as they need, tailored to their specific requirements, ensuring they are never limited by data scarcity.

 

Bias Mitigation: Synthetic data can be used to reduce bias in AI models. By creating balanced datasets, developers can mitigate the biases that often arise in real-world data, thus making AI more fair and equitable.

Challenges and Ethical Considerations

 

While synthetic data offers significant advantages, it is not without challenges and ethical considerations. Generating truly representative synthetic data can be a complex task, and the quality of synthetic data relies heavily on the design and expertise of the generative models. Moreover, the potential misuse of synthetic data, especially in generating deepfakes or disinformation, raises important ethical concerns that must be addressed.
